North Carolina Statutes

§ 106-568.36 — Maximum levy after 1988

The maximum amount which may be authorized in any referendum held pursuant to the provisions of this Article during 1989 or thereafter, and the maximum amount which may be assessed, collected or levied for any year after 1988 by the Board of Directors of Tobacco Associates pursuant to the provisions of this Article, is four dollars ($4.00) per acre per year on all flue-cured tobacco acreage in the State, or, under the alternate method for levy of assessment set out in G.S. 106-568.34, one-fifth cent (1/5¢) per pound of the flue-cured tobacco marketed by each farmer. (1979, c. 474, s. 2; 1987, c. 294, s. 13; 1989, c. 349, s. 6.)
